Mammootty's houses raided in luxury vehicle scam: From Rolls-Royce to Dubai properties, here's all about the superstar’s financial empire
The Enforcement Directorate (ED) searched Malayalam superstar Mammootty's Chennai property as part of a luxury vehicle scam investigation. The operation targeted a network allegedly using fake documents, including those linked to the Indian Army, ...

The operation was part of a larger crackdown on a suspected luxury vehicle scam. Earlier, the ED had raided 17 other locations connected to popular Malayalam actors, including Prithviraj Sukumaran, Dulquer Salmaan, and Amith Chakalakkal, as well as vehicle dealers, workshops, and business establishments in Ernakulam, Thrissur, Kozhikode, Malappuram, Kottayam, and Coimbatore.
According to officials, preliminary findings suggest that a Coimbatore-based network allegedly used fake documents, purportedly showing links to the Indian Army, the US Embassy, and the Ministry of External Affairs, to register luxury cars fraudulently in states like Arunachal Pradesh and Himachal Pradesh. These vehicles were then sold at undervalued prices to wealthy buyers, including some from the film industry.
The investigation reportedly covers a wider web of alleged tax evasion, smuggling of imported vehicles, and foreign exchange violations. The ED’s Kochi Zonal Office coordinated the raids across Kerala and Tamil Nadu, including Mammootty’s Chennai premises.
Mammootty’s Wealth and Car Collection
With a film career spanning over 50 years, Mammootty is among India’s most successful and highest-paid actors. As per a Times of India report from 2024, his estimated net worth exceeds ₹340 crore. He reportedly charges around ₹10 crore per film and earns up to ₹4 crore for brand endorsements.Beyond acting, Mammootty owns several business ventures, including Megastar Cinemas and Mammootty Theatres, and has made significant real estate investments in Kerala and Dubai. His garage boasts an impressive lineup of cars, featuring a Rolls-Royce Phantom, Range Rover Vogue, and Mercedes-Benz S-Class.
On the work front, the veteran actor recently wrapped up the Hyderabad schedule of his upcoming political espionage thriller Patriot, directed by Mahesh Narayanan. The next shooting schedule is expected to begin in the United Kingdom from October 15.
